About the apprenticeship

Duties

● Developing, planning and organising play activities for children aged 3 to 11 years of age.
● Using play activities to help children develop socially and emotionally
● Setting up play equipment and making sure play areas are safe.
● Supervising children for fair behaviour during play, dealing with any minor injuries.
● Liaising with parents/carers.
● Preparing snacks for the children.
